容器服务性能调优:教授的实战策略
|
在当今的云计算环境中,容器服务已经成为了应用部署和管理的主流方式。然而,如何充分利用容器服务并实现性能调优,却是一门深奥的学问。这正是我,一位有着多年教学和实践经验的教授,想要与大家分享的实战策略。 首先,理解你的应用是调优的第一步。每个应用都有其自身的性能瓶颈,可能是CPU、内存、磁盘I/O或者是网络带宽。你需要深入到应用的内部,使用如cAdvisor、Prometheus等监控工具,收集并分析应用的运行数据,找出性能瓶颈所在。 其次,合理配置资源是关键。在容器服务中,你可以为每个容器设定特定的CPU和内存限制,但这并不意味着你应该随意设定。你需要根据应用的实际需求和性能瓶颈,进行精细化的资源分配。例如,对于CPU密集型应用,你可以适当增加CPU资源;对于内存敏感的应用,你需要确保其有足够的内存空间。 再者,优化网络和存储也是不可忽视的部分。对于需要频繁进行网络通信的应用,你可以使用如Service Mesh等技术来优化网络性能;对于对I/O性能要求高的应用,你可能需要考虑使用更快的存储设备,如SSD。 此外,持续集成和持续部署(CI/CD)也是实现性能调优的重要手段。通过自动化测试和部署,你可以快速发现并修复性能问题,确保应用的稳定性和高效性。 最后,但同样重要的是,你需要持续学习和跟踪最新的技术动态。容器服务领域的技术发展迅速,新的工具和最佳实践不断涌现,只有保持开放的心态和学习的热情,你才能在性能调优的道路上不断前进。 总的来说,容器服务性能调优是一个涉及多方面知识和技能的综合任务,需要你具备深入的应用理解、精细的资源管理、敏锐的技术洞察力,以及持续的学习和实践。希望我的这些实战策略能对你有所帮助,让我们一起在容器服务的世界中探索和优化,实现应用的最优性能。 (编辑:PHP编程网 - 襄阳站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

浙公网安备 33038102330434号